Ground Hydrant Installation Cost Overview
Typical price ranges for ground hydrant installation vary based on project scope and complexity. The overall costs generally fall within a certain spectrum, depending on factors such as location, site conditions, and specific project requirements.
$1,500 - $3,500 (Basic residential or small-scale installations)
$3,500 - $7,000 (Larger or more complex projects with additional features)
| Project Type |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Residential Ground Hydrant | $1,500 - $3,000 |
| Commercial Ground Hydrant | $4,000 - $8,000 |
| Municipal or Public Project | $5,000 - $15,000 |
| Industrial Site Installation | $7,000 - $20,000 |
| Rehabilitation or Replacement | $2,000 - $6,000 |
What affects the cost
Several factors can influence the overall expense of ground hydrant installation projects. Understanding these elements can help in planning and comparing options effectively.
- Materials used: The type and quality of materials selected can impact costs, including piping, fittings, and hydrant components.
- Size and scope: The number of hydrants and the complexity of the installation area influence the project's scale and associated expenses.
- Labor complexity: Site conditions and the difficulty of excavation or installation procedures can affect labor requirements and costs.
- Permitting and regulations: Compliance with local permits and regulatory requirements may add to project expenses and timeline.
- Additional features or extras: Optional components such as monitoring systems, protective coverings, or specialized fittings can increase overall costs.
